SATA Questions For Select All That Apply questions, ALL correct options must be selected to receive full
credit. There is no partial credit on the NCLEX — treat each option as an independent
true/false statement.
Clinical Reasoning Read each clinical scenario carefully before selecting your answer. Apply the nursing
process (AADPIE): Assessment → Analysis → Diagnosis → Planning → Implementation
→ Evaluation.
Priority Questions When a question asks for a 'priority' or 'first' action, use frameworks such as: ABCs
(Airway, Breathing, Circulation), Maslow's Hierarchy of Needs, and SATA Safety first.
